Summary
Overview
Work History
Education
Skills
Workingstatus
Timeline
Generic

Rajesh Mohanty

Scarborough,ON

Summary

  • Dynamic and results-oriented PL/SQL Developer with over 10 years of experience seeking a challenging position where I can leverage my expertise in PL/SQL programming, IBM DataStage, Unix, Linux, WinSCP,XML and IBM Workload Scheduler to contribute effectively to the success of the organization. Seeking an environment which provides carrier growth through a continuous learning process and helps in keeping myself dynamic, visionary and competitive with the changing scenario of the corporate world
  • Highly skilled PL/SQL Developer with a proven track record of designing, developing, and maintaining complex database solutions. Proficient in writing efficient SQL queries, stored procedures, triggers, and functions. Extensive experience in IBM DataStage for ETL processes, along with expertise in Unix, Linux, WinSCP, and IBM Workload Scheduler for efficient data management and automation. Strong problem-solving abilities and a collaborative team player.
  • 3+ years as a Tech lead and IT Team Lead roles for various high budget IT Projects in Utility domain.
  • 8 + years in production Support role for multiple Oracle, IBM , Off the Shelf and Customized applications
  • 10 years cumulative experience in utilities, healthcare, banking, insurance (P&C) and finance domains

Overview

10
10
years of professional experience

Work History

PL/SQL Developer

Enbridge Gas Distribution
11.2023 - Current
  • Planning Sprints, working on KANBAN Boards, Distributing Stories points
  • Leading a team in a highly paced environment to delivery a high budget project well before deadline with minimal post go live defects
  • Involved in full SDLC cycle of Planning, Analysis, Design, Development, Testing and Implementation
  • Part of the Team which designed the ER Diagram
  • Wrote sequences for automatic generation of unique keys to support primary and foreign key constraints in data conversions
  • Created and modified PL/SQL and SQL Loader scripts for data conversions
  • Developed and modified triggers, packages, functions and stored procedures for data conversions and PL/SQL procedures to create database objects dynamically based on user inputs
  • Wrote SQL, PL/SQL programs required to retrieve data using cursors and exception handling
  • Worked on XML along with PL/SQL to develop and modify web forms
  • Fine-tuned procedures/SQL queries for maximum efficiency in various databases using Oracle Hints, for Rule based optimization
  • Created custom Oracle Application Framework (OAF) Pages for Custom application
  • Responsible for Defect Triage and resolution
  • Created Unix scripts for proactive monitoring of daily batch processes.
  • Creating Custom XML BI Publisher Reports.
  • Develop BO Webi reports for users.
  • Creating Weekly Status Reports.
  • Making Project estimations.
  • Developed requirements for system modifications and new system installations.
  • Reviewed project requirements to identify customer expectations and resources needed to meet goals.
  • Leveraged Agile methodologies to move development lifecycle rapidly through initial prototyping to enterprise-quality testing and final implementation.
  • Coordinated testing and validation procedures through software development lifecycle.
  • Resolved customer issues by establishing workarounds and solutions to debug and create defect fixes.
  • Analyzed user needs and software requirements to determine design feasibility.
  • Analyzed code and corrected errors to optimize output.
  • Recommended improvements to facilitate team and project workflow.
  • Conducted peer code reviews to ensure quality and adherence to coding standards.
  • Collaborated with cross-functional teams to gather requirements and translate business needs into technical specifications.

PL/SQL Developer

Cognizant Technology Solutions
Toronto, ON
09.2021 - 11.2023
  • Organized and Facilitated Creating Sprints, performing Sprint Planning including daily stand-ups, demos and retrospectives
  • Conducting system study and coordinating with team members for requirement mapping, system design and implementation
  • Involved in full development cycle of Planning, Analysis, Design, Development, Testing and Implementation
  • Part of the Team which designed the ER Diagrams
  • Mentored multiple teams to be self directed with strong conflict resolution, transparency and determination skills
  • Wrote sequences for automatic generation of unique keys to support primary foreign key constraints in data conversions
  • Created and modified PL/SQL stored procedures and triggers
  • SQL Loader scripts for data conversions
  • Developed and modified triggers, packages, functions and stored procedures for data conversions and/SQL procedures to create database objects dynamically based on user inputs
  • Experience in working on IBM TWS(Tivoli workload Scheduler)
  • Contributed towards resource management, status reporting, organizing weekly onshore-offshore status meetings
  • Wrote SQL, PL/SQL programs required to retrieve data using cursors and exception handling
  • Worked on XML along with PL/SQL to develop and modify web forms
  • Fine-tuned procedures/SQL queries for maximum efficiency in various databases using Oracle Hints, for Rule based optimization
  • Perform Root Cause Analysis (RCA) on Severity 1 and 2 production Issues
  • Created Exception handling packages and procedures to help ease the process of debugging and display
  • Worked on Supporting multiple applications hosted on Amazon Web Services(AWS)
  • Creating Unix shell scripts for deployment across multiple environments.
  • Collaborated with other teams such as DBA's, Data Architects and System Administrators for resolving any issues related to Oracle databases.
  • Monitored system resources utilization like CPU utilization, memory usage.
  • Optimized SQL queries for better performance by analyzing execution plans and query optimization techniques.
  • Created scripts to automate daily tasks such as backup jobs and scheduled jobs.
  • Prepared documentation for all the processes involved in developing a software product.
  • Participated in Database Design Discussions with Business Analysts and Application Teams.
  • Identified and resolved various issues related to data integrity, security and performance tuning in Oracle databases.
  • Created test cases for unit testing of new or existing PL and SQL code.
  • Analyzed user requirements and developed stored procedures to meet those requirements.
  • Deployed production ready applications on multiple environments.
  • Provided technical support including troubleshooting problems reported by users and developers during application development phase.
  • Developed stored procedures, functions and packages using PLSQL to support the application development needs.
  • Developed shell scripts for automating routine maintenance tasks like index rebuilds and reorgs.
  • Performed debugging of existing PLSQL code as part of bug fixing activities.
  • Performed Database Administration Tasks such as Creating Users, Granting Privileges.
  • Involved in Performance Tuning activities like creating Indexes, Partitioning Tables.
  • Designed complex database objects like tables, views, triggers and indexes as per business requirements.
  • Implemented exception handling mechanism using error logging package in PLSQL.
  • Tested databases and performed bug fixes.
  • Optimized SQL queries and stored procedures, reducing execution time by significant percentages.
  • Created and maintained database objects including tables, views, indexes, and triggers to ensure data integrity and performance efficiency.
  • Designed and developed complex SQL queries for data analysis and extraction to support business decisions.
  • Utilized version control systems to manage changes to SQL scripts and database objects, ensuring consistency across environments.
  • Analyzed and resolved complex database and data integrity issues to maintain high availability and reliability.
  • Implemented ETL processes using SQL and additional tools to migrate data across different systems.
  • Participated in data modeling sessions, contributing to the development of logical and physical database designs.
  • Automated routine database tasks through scripting, reducing manual intervention and improving productivity.
  • Documented SQL development processes, creating a knowledge base for best practices and troubleshooting.
  • Collaborated with cross-functional teams to gather requirements and translate business needs into technical specifications.
  • Evaluated and integrated new database technologies and tools to enhance development efficiency and system capabilities.
  • Developed database schemas, scripts, and models in collaboration with application developers to meet project requirements.
  • Monitored database performance metrics and made adjustments to configurations and hardware to meet scalability demands.
  • Conducted database tuning and performance monitoring to ensure optimal system functionality.
  • Provided technical support and training to end-users on database querying and reporting tools.
  • Conducted peer code reviews to ensure quality and adherence to coding standards.
  • Wrote user manuals and other documentation for roll-out in customer training sessions.
  • Collaborated with support team to assist client stakeholders with emergent technical issues and develop effective solutions.
  • Improved and corrected existing software and system applications.
  • Identified opportunities for process improvements to decrease in support calls.
  • Integrated object-oriented design and development techniques into projects to support usability goals

IT Team Lead- SQL

TATA Consultancy Services
Toronto, Ontario
10.2014 - 09.2021
  • Led the development and optimization of PL/SQL code for critical business applications, resulting in improved performance and scalability
  • Designed and implemented complex stored procedures, triggers, and functions to meet business requirements
  • Collaborated with cross-functional teams to gather requirements and deliver high-quality solutions within project timelines
  • Utilized IBM DataStage for ETL processes, ensuring seamless data integration and transformation
  • Automated data management tasks using Unix shell scripting, Linux, WinSCP, and IBM Workload Scheduler, reducing manual efforts by 30%
  • Developed and maintained PL/SQL code for various modules of enterprise applications, adhering to coding standards and best practices
  • Conducted performance tuning and optimization of SQL queries, enhancing application efficiency
  • Worked closely with QA teams to perform unit testing and resolve defects in a timely manner
  • Provided production support and troubleshooting for database-related issues, ensuring minimal downtime
  • Contributed towards resource management, status reporting, organizing weekly onshore-offshore status meetings.
  • Coordinated closely with project managers to ensure timely completion of tasks.
  • Participated in meetings with stakeholders to discuss requirements gathering, system architecture design, testing procedures.
  • Resolved conflicts between team members in a professional manner.
  • Created training materials for new hires onboarding process into the IT team.
  • Managed team of 8 software engineers and provided technical guidance on projects.
  • Conducted regular performance reviews for the IT team members.
  • Documented various processes related to system implementation and maintenance activities for future reference.
  • Assisted in developing strategies for improving overall efficiency of the IT department.

Education

Bachelor's degree in Electrical Engineering -

Biju Patnaik University of Technology - Bhubaneshwar, Orissa
05.2014

Skills

  • Utility, Manufacturing Domain Knowledge
  • Business Process Analysis
  • Requirements Gathering
  • Data Analysis
  • Stakeholder Management
  • Project Coordination
  • Systems Implementation
  • Risk Management
  • Communication Skills
  • Problem-Solving
  • SQL
  • PL/SQL
  • Unix
  • XML
  • Interface development using Oracle seeded APIs
  • Oracle E Business Suite (FA, QUALITY, INVENTORY)
  • Oracle Application Framework (OAF)
  • BI Publisher XML reports
  • Conversions
  • Oracle Workflow builder
  • IBM Infosphere DataStage
  • SAP BO Webi Reports
  • Java Tools Used
  • SQL Developer
  • PL/SQL Developer
  • Oracle E-Business Suite
  • J Developer
  • Oracle Forms Developer
  • Oracle Reports Developer
  • SAP BO Webi
  • IBM Infosphere Datatsage9
  • Putty
  • WinSCP
  • Toad Methods
  • Agile Methodology
  • Waterfall Methodology
  • Utilities Domain
  • Insurance Domain
  • Agile development methodologies
  • Java
  • Data Validation
  • Performance Improvements
  • Transaction Management
  • Performance Tuning
  • Hardware upgrades
  • SQL reporting
  • Relational databases
  • Data Migration
  • Documentation Management
  • Data Warehousing
  • Database Design
  • Analytical and Critical Thinking
  • Planning
  • Problem Resolution
  • Time Management
  • Attention to Detail

Workingstatus

PR

Timeline

PL/SQL Developer

Enbridge Gas Distribution
11.2023 - Current

PL/SQL Developer

Cognizant Technology Solutions
09.2021 - 11.2023

IT Team Lead- SQL

TATA Consultancy Services
10.2014 - 09.2021

Bachelor's degree in Electrical Engineering -

Biju Patnaik University of Technology - Bhubaneshwar, Orissa
Rajesh Mohanty